Macro and Micro Nutritional Effect on Seed Yield of Onion

Journal Title: Advances in Research - Year 2017, Vol 12, Issue 1

Abstract

An experiment was carried out at the Agronomy Research field of Sher-e-Bangla Agricultural University, Dhaka, Bangladesh during the period from November, 2013 to April, 2014 with a view to observe the effect of micronutrients (Zn, B and Mn) with different levels of macronutrients (NPKS fertilizers) on onion (Allium cepa L.) seed yield. The experiment was conducted with four levels of micronutrients viz. M1= Zn0B0Mn0 kg/ha, M2= Zn4B1Mn2 kg/ha, M3= Zn6B2Mn3 kg/ha and M4= Zn8B3Mn4 kg/ha and three doses of macronutrients viz. F1= N57P21K39S9 kg/ha, F2= N114P42K78S18 kg/ha and F3 =N171P63K117S27 kg/ha. All doses of micro and macronutrients are applied to the soil. Application of micronutrients and different doses of macronutrients increased number of umbels/plot, number of seeds per umbel, weight of seeds per umbel, seed yield per plant. The highest seed yield (879.9 kg/ha) were recorded from M3 treatment and the lowest seed yield (787.4 kg/ha). The positive effects of micronutrients were found in order of M3> M4> M2> M1. The F2 treatment produced the highest seed yield (957.6 kg/ha) and F1 treatment produced lowest (776.6 kg/ha). The positive effects were found in order of F2> F3> F1. Amongst the treatment combinations, M3F2 produced the highest seed yield (1027.0 kg/ha) and M1F1 produced the lowest yield (734.4 kg/ha).
